Sent Home With Wrong Family, Now-Adult Twin Sues
Posted May 28, 2008, 10:34 am CDT
By Martha Neil
An identical twin who discovered, as an adult, that she had been sent home from a Canary Islands hospital in Spain with the wrong family has sued over the alleged mix-up.
Now 35, the unnamed woman discovered she had a twin when she was mistaken for her sister by a stranger in a shop at age 28, according to the London Times. A DNA test confirmed the relationship. Meanwhile, her sister and the rest of the family believed the baby they took home in the plaintiff's place was in fact the other twin.
